Errors will be corrected where discovered, and Lowe's reserves the right to revoke any stated offer and to correct any errors, inaccuracies or omissions including after an order has been submitted.Public Address announcements are restricted to emergency situations only and must be requested through University Police at (662) 915-7234 or during games at (662) 915-4899. Many announcements are requested, but only emergency situations can be addressed through PA announcements in Vaught-Hemingway. To properly address these situations, U.P.D. is responsible for determining the level of importance of any requested announcement. Southeastern Conference rules do not permit artificial noise-makers to be brought into or used in the stadium. Anyone found violating this policy is subject to ejection.




The SEC implemented this rule in order to prevent the distraction of the participants and officials in the game. Backpacks or any bag larger than 12″ x 12″ x 12″ are not allowed into Vaught-Hemingway. Ole Miss is following the advice of security officials who have designated backpacks and large bags as a security risk.  Also, the searching of backpacks would contribute to longer lines for security checks at gates. Ole Miss recommends the use of clear bags smaller than 8 ½” by 11” (1 per person) for carrying items into Vaught-Hemingway. Banners and signs larger than 8.5″ x 11″ may not be brought into Vaught-Hemingway. Banners and signs in Vaught-Hemingway can obstruct the view of other fans. Also, Ole Miss must ensure that it protects corporate sponsors regarding signage in Vaught-Hemingway. The possession or consumption of alcohol in the general seating areas of Vaught-Hemingway is expressly prohibited by University policy. Stadium personnel and law enforcement officials will enforce this policy.




In an effort to encourage an enjoyable experience for all fans in Vaught-Hemingway, persons who are intoxicated or who are in possession of alcohol will be removed from the stadium. Cameras are permitted inside Vaught-Hemingway for both fans and working news media. All photos taken in Vaught-Hemingway must be for editorial or personal use only and cannot be used for commercial purposes. The sale of images with current student-athletes is against NCAA rules and can risk the eligibility of Ole Miss student-athletes. Additionally, any commercial use of photos of Vaught-Hemingway, campus landmarks or identifiable campus elements is prohibited without the prior written approval of the University. Anyone leaving the stadium must have an unused/un-scanned ticket to return to the stadium. Once a ticket has been scanned or the stub removed, it may not be used again for re-entry, unless otherwise directed by Ole Miss officials in emergency situations. SEC rules prohibit “Pass Out Checks” from being issued.




The University of Mississippi is a smoke free campus. Smoking is prohibited at all times, and at all locations of the Oxford campus, including University-owned facilities, properties and grounds. In 2012, the University announced the Oxford campus as smoke free. The throwing of objects from the stands is strictly prohibited and is cause for immediate ejection. Also, fans may not go onto the playing field at anytime before, during, or after games. Thrown objects can cause serious injury. Ole Miss takes very seriously the safety of fans, coaches, athletes, and officials. Ole Miss will act promptly and accordingly if the safety of any individual is in jeopardy. Visitors to Vaught-Hemingway Stadium may be subject to search.  Security cameras are also used in the stadium and by entering the stadium, you consent to this recording. With heightened security now a way of life, Ole Miss will do everything possible to provide a secure environment for its fans. Please be cooperative with our security officials during your visit to Vaught-Hemingway.




They are there for your safety. Ole Miss encourages fans to arrive early and to bring as few personal items into the stadium as possible. Any portable seat that impedes on the comfort and enjoyment of a fan in an adjacent seat (in front, behind, or to the side) is prohibited. Wide stadium seats can overlap into the seat of the fan next to you. Any stadium seat measuring 16 inches wide or less will fit into any seat in Vaught-Hemingway. All seats with arm rests are prohibited. Please be aware that some seats larger than 16” (including seats with Ole Miss logos) are sold outside the stadium because fans use these for other purposes other than Ole Miss sporting events. For the comfort and safety of all Rebel fans, please follow these guidelines for items brought into Vaught-Hemingway Stadium. All persons, over the age of 12 months, must present a ticket for admission to Vaught-Hemingway Stadium. This policy is for the convenience and safety of all ticket holders. Even the smallest of fans sitting on their parents’ lap can be an inconvenience to the fan sitting in the next seat and a safety risk for the child. Umbrellas are not allowed in Vaught-Hemingway Stadium. Umbrellas are a sight obstruction for other fans, and can be a safety hazard. Ole Miss advises the use of ponchos or other wearable rain gear for inclement weather. Once admitted to the stadium , no ticker holder shall be permitted to leave and re-enter the facility on that ticket.In the event of inclement weather, home team game management shall have the authority to waive this policy. Fans should be advised that the public address announcer will alert fans as to the waiving of this policy once a decision is made.




Off-Campus Shuttles Weather Policy In the event that the National Weather Service in Memphis issues a severe weather warning pre or post game, the Oxford game day shuttles will suspend service on pickups and drop offs until the warning is lifted by the National Weather Service. This is for the protection and safety of our staff, the riders, and shuttle drivers. In the event The University of Mississippi institutes a weather delay during the football game, shuttle service will be suspended until the weather delay is lifted by the University. Riders are advised to seek shelter in a campus building, or remain in the stadium under cover. This policy is being instituted for the protection of the shuttle patrons to prevent them from being exposed to hazardous weather conditions while waiting to leave campus back to the shuttle sites.
